Jail Time For Alberta Man Charged After Break & Enter at Moose Mountain

A Medicine Hat, Alberta man has been sentenced to jail time on charges relating to a break and enter and stolen vehicle.
In the early morning hours of July 2nd, Carlyle RCMP responded to a break and enter in progress at a business in the R.M. of Moose Mountain, where surveillance video showed a male in a vehicle reported stolen from Alameda the day prior.
The suspect had left when Mounties arrived but was later arrested without incident at a rural property near Kennedy, Saskatchewan.
25-year-old Skyler Darr was sentenced to five-and-a-half months in prison on charges of possession of property obtained by crime, break and enter with intent.
